Aims and Scope:
Current Molecular and Systems Pharmacology publishes original research, reviews/mini-reviews, short communications and guest-edited thematic issues that focus on the drug action at the molecular and systems level. The journal covers a broad spectrum of topics in molecular and systems pharmacology, emphasizing the key areas including molecular pharmacology, drug-target interactions, signaling pathways, pharmacogenomics, targeted drug delivery systems, polypharmacology, systems biology approaches, and the integration of multi-omics data (genomics, proteomics, metabolomics) to predict drug responses and toxicity.
